 Front acts were Farenheight 43 and Sandwich. Farenheight 43's from Australia and described their music as being "acoustic college pop-rock", comparing their sound to Goo Goo Dolls and Switchfoot. Their influences include Angels & Airwaves, Paramore, Mayday Parade and John Mayer. They played one of their famous songs, "The Rescue" and "Angels Lullaby". There were not a lot of people yet in the front row seats since it was just around 7 at that time when they hit the stage.  Still, we were glad to see them perform.  I downloaded a couple of their songs when I got home.

For Sandwich, their music has much evolved overtime from heavy and underground sounds like grunge, hard rock, and rap-rock from their early albums to a more youthful and dynamic music since “Five On The Floor".  They entertained us with "Sugod" and "Betamax".

Last but definitely not the least would have to be Gin Blossoms.  Opening act was was "Follow You Down".  Everyone went berserk to this and started clapping.  Their latest album, No Chocolate Cake, went out last Sept 2010.  They played their songs alternately from their 90's hits and the ones from their new album.
